Case Converter - Fix Formatting Fast
Capitalization problems happen constantly. Copy-paste from various sources. Voice typing mistakes. Data imports.
Essential conversions:
- UPPERCASE: Headlines, emphasis, postal addresses
- lowercase: Email addresses, hashtags, URLs
- Title Case: Headlines, book titles, proper titles
- Sentence case: Body text, descriptions, natural writing
Save time: Fix entire paragraphs in seconds. No manual retyping.

Character Counter for Social Media
Platform limits vary:
- Twitter: 280 characters
- Facebook: No limit, but 40-80 optimal
- Instagram caption: 2,200 characters
- LinkedIn post: 3,000 characters
- Meta description: 155-160 characters
Count in real-time: Write and watch counter update. Hit limits precisely.

Readability Analyzer
Readable content performs better. Clear writing engages readers and improves SEO.
Metrics tracked:
- Reading grade level (aim for 8th-9th grade)
- Flesch Reading Ease score (60-70 is good)
- Average sentence length (15-20 words ideal)
- Passive voice percentage (under 10%)
- Complex word percentage
Improve scores: Shorten sentences. Use simpler words. Reduce passive voice.
